The ingredients needed to make Scain's comfort chicken noodle soup for crockpot:
  1. Get 1 lb chicken tenderloins
  2. Get 2 celery stalks, chopped
  3. Make ready 2 carrots, chopped
  4. Get 1 small onion, chopped
  5. Get 2 garlic cloves, chopped
  6. Prepare 4 tbsp butter, divided
  7. Prepare 4 cups chicken broth
  8. Prepare 1 chicken boullion cube
  9. Take Parmesan cheese rind
  10. Make ready 1 tbsp garlic powder
  11. Make ready 1 tbsp onion powder
  12. Prepare dash cayenne
  13. Get 1 bay leaf
  14. Take 8 oz egg noodles

Instructions to make Scain's comfort chicken noodle soup for crockpot:
  1. In a skillet, add 2 tbsp butter, then add veggies. Stir off and on for about 10 min. Don't let onions brown.
  2. In another skillet, add 2 tbsp butter, add chicken, garlic powder, onion powder and cayenne. Cook until chicken is no longer pink. I chopped my chicken the same size as my veggies
  3. Turn crockpot to high, add veggies and chicken
  4. Then add broth, boullion, bay leaf and cheese rind. Cover, and cook for 3-4 hrs until carrots and celery are tender.
  5. In a pot add water to boil noodles, cook per package instructions. Drain
  6. To serve, put noodles in a bowl then top with your soup. (My hubby doesn't like soggy noodles, so by doing it this way, your noodles keep their texture even the next day ;) )
